告别啸叫与底噪:A-59P全能型语音处理模组深度拆解与开发指南
一、 核心痛点解决:它凭什么号称“全能”?
市面上普通的语音模组大多只能解决单一问题(比如仅做降噪或仅做回声消除),但A-59P直接将三大核心算法硬核集成到了一块仅有 37.5mm x 16mm 的邮票孔小板上:
-
AI ENC (人工智能降噪)
-
痛点:传统降噪对稳态噪声(如风扇声)有效,但对非稳态噪声(如键盘敲击、汽车鸣笛、甚至对着麦吹风)束手无策。
-
A-59P方案:依托内置AI算法,能够精准识别并压制上述突发噪音,保留纯净人声。实测降噪深度可达 45dB-90dB。
-
-
AEC (声学回声消除)
-
痛点:免提通话时,喇叭声音被麦克风收回导致的“啸叫”和“回声”。
-
A-59P方案:支持高达 100dB 的回音消除能力,最大支持 100ms 的空间延迟消除。即便喇叭音量开到最大,也能保持全双工流畅通话。
-
-
BF (波束成形技术)
-
痛点:全向麦克风容易拾取四周杂音,信噪比差。
-
A-59P方案:在双数字麦克风模式下,支持双麦单波束和双麦双波束定向拾音。就像用手电筒聚光一样,只接收特定角度(可配置60度范围)的人声,极大提升远场拾音质量。
-
二、 极客必看:炸裂的接口兼容性与电气特性
对于底层开发而言,最怕遇到“中看不中用”的硬件。A-59P最让我惊艳的,是它将全接口覆盖做到了极致,无论你的主控板处于何种阶段,都能无缝对接:
-
数字音频控:支持标准 I2S 接口(飞利浦标准对齐,48kHz/16bit,主模式)。D_IN 和 D_OUT 独立,可直接与主流SoC进行纯数字音频传输,杜绝模拟信号传输带来的底噪干扰。
-
传统模拟派:提供差分模拟输出(MICOUT_P/N 和 USP_OUT_P/N),信噪比高达 106dB,最大输出幅度 1Vrms,可直接驱动耳机或小功率功放。
-
快速原型验证:原生支持 USB 免驱(WIN/Android/Linux 桌面系统即插即用),极大缩短了前期Demo的开发周期。
-
Host端动态调控:预留了 SPI 从机接口。主控MCU只需拉低
SPI_K引脚,即可通过SPI总线实时改写A-59P的内部寄存器,动态调整降噪等级或拾音距离。
电气避坑指南:
-
供电选择:支持 3.3V 或 5V 单电源输入(Pin 12 / Pin 13),但不能同时接。
-
数字麦供电限流:Pin 23 输出的 3.3V 仅供外部数字麦克风使用,最大负载严禁超过 30mA,否则极易烧毁内部LDO。建议在画板时将其与主控的 3.3V 隔离开。
三、 场景化应用:13种工作模式如何选?
A-59P 的固件架构非常灵活,主要分为模拟麦克风和数字麦克风(PDM)两大阵营,并结合 USB / 模拟 / I2S 三种输出方式,衍生出十几种工作模式。这里我为大家梳理几个最常用的实战拓扑:
拓扑 1:单数字麦克风 + USB 输出(模式五)—— 极简上位机对接
-
适用场景:视频会议摄像头、带通话功能的IPC。
-
接线要点:DAT/CLK 接数字麦,USB_D+/D- 直连主控。由于是纯数字链路,底噪几乎为零。消回音参考信号(LINE_IN)建议从功放输入端(小信号端)直接引接,可免去阻容分压网络。
拓扑 2:双数字麦克风 + 波束成形 + I2S 输出(模式十二)—— 高端远场拾音
-
适用场景:智能音箱、车载语音助手。
-
接线要点:两颗数字麦分布在两侧,A-59P 的 I2S 接口与主SoC对接。此模式下可开启双波束定向拾音,通过 SPI 接口,Host 端甚至可以动态调整波束的朝向角和中轴角。
拓扑 3:模拟麦克风 + 纯数字音频闭环(模式四)—— 老旧主板升级改造
-
适用场景:主控只有 I2S 接口且没有 ADC/DAC 的老旧方案。
-
接线要点:需要拆除模组上的 R1 电阻,将 A-59P 的 D_IN 和 D_OUT 分别与主控的 I2S 输出和输入相连,利用模组自带的 ADC 和 DAC 完成语音的双向转换。
四、 开发调试技巧:硬件级参数切换
在产品量产或现场调试时,频繁烧录固件是不现实的。A-59P 提供了非常巧妙的硬件引脚复用方案:
模组预留了 T1(Pin 9) 和 T2(Pin 11) 两个参数选择引脚。默认悬空为高电平(中距离模式)。开发者只需在画板时预留对地 0 欧姆电阻的位置,即可通过上下拉组合,实现四种拾音距离的硬件级切换:
|
T1 状态 |
T2 状态 |
工作模式 |
拾音距离 |
适用场景 |
|---|---|---|---|---|
|
高 (悬空) |
高 (悬空) |
中距离 |
0.5 - 2 米 |
通用会议设备、门禁 |
|
高 (悬空) |
低 (接地) |
近距离 |
0.1 - 0.2 米 |
对讲机、桌面麦克风 |
|
低 (接地) |
高 (悬空) |
远距离 |
0.5 - 5 米 |
大办公室、教室 |
|
低 (接地) |
低 (接地) |
超远距离 |
0.5 - 8 米 |
展厅、空旷仓库 |
五、 总结与展望
总的来说,A-59P 是一款极具诚意的水桶机型。它没有明显的短板,邮票孔的封装让它既可以做成独立的USB外设,也能直接 SMT 贴片到主板内部。
对于初创团队来说,直接采用 A-59P 可以省去购买昂贵声学测试设备的成本,跳过繁琐的底层DSP算法移植,将精力完全集中在核心业务逻辑和产品外观上。在当前内卷严重的硬件赛道,这无疑是一种“降本增效”的利器。
AtomGit 是由开放原子开源基金会联合 CSDN 等生态伙伴共同推出的新一代开源与人工智能协作平台。平台坚持“开放、中立、公益”的理念,把代码托管、模型共享、数据集托管、智能体开发体验和算力服务整合在一起,为开发者提供从开发、训练到部署的一站式体验。
更多推荐



所有评论(0)